Preparing Your Property for Demolition
Preparing a property for demolition includes numerous substantial actions to assure the process proceeds smoothly and securely. Initially, homeowner need to conduct a detailed inspection to determine any unsafe products, such as asbestos or lead paint, which must be taken care of according to neighborhood regulations. Next, utilities, including electrical energy, water, and gas, require to be detached to avoid accidents throughout demolition.
It is additionally vital to educate next-door neighbors about the approaching demolition, as this can help minimize concerns and foster good relationships (legendary demolition houston). Clearing the location of personal valuables, vehicles, and landscape design can assist in accessibility for demolition devices
In addition, marking residential property boundaries is essential to avoid elbowing in on nearby lots. Confirming that all needed authorizations are obtained prior to beginning is important to conform with local legislations. By taking these primary steps, property owners can help ensure a secure and effective demolition process.

Personal safety tools (PPE) works as the first line of defense for employees participated in house and garage demolition. Necessary PPE includes hard hats to safeguard against dropping debris, safety goggles to shield the eyes from dust and flying bits, and gloves to safeguard hands from sharp items and chemicals. Steel-toed boots give required foot protection, while high-visibility vests assure that employees are conveniently seen in hectic atmospheres. Respirators might additionally be needed to strain dangerous dirt and fumes. By sticking to PPE standards, workers can significantly decrease the risk of injury and enhance safety and security on demolition websites. Appropriate training in the use and upkeep of PPE further assures its efficiency throughout the demolition procedure.
Dangerous Material Handling
Effective handling of hazardous products is crucial in guaranteeing security during house and garage demolition. Prior to starting any kind of demolition project, an extensive evaluation of the website is required to identify possible dangerous materials, such as asbestos, lead paint, and mold. Correct training in handling these compounds is critical for all workers included. Making use of appropriate containment approaches, including securing off affected areas and making use of specific tools, minimizes direct exposure risks. Furthermore, employees should be furnished with the required individual protective tools (PPE) to guard against breathing or skin contact. Adhering to local laws for unsafe waste disposal is critical, making sure that all products are eliminated and taken care of safely. Overall, thorough preparation and adherence to safety methods can minimize risks related to dangerous products throughout demolition.
